Encyclopedia
3 entries
Hemavata
Person一位夜叉首領,佛陀信徒遇難時可祈求他護佑,曾出席《大集會經》的說法,是 Sātāgira 的朋友。
A yakkha chief to be invoked by the Buddha’s followers in time of need, present at the teaching of the Mahāsamaya Sutta, and a friend of Sātāgira.
一條河流,是《跋羅低耶本生》故事發生的場景。
A river, the setting of the Bhallātiya Jātaka.
閻浮提的一個異端教派,因其成員居於喜馬拉雅山而得名;他們主張菩薩並非凡夫俗子,外道也能具足五神通,且個體(補特伽羅)異於五蘊。
A heretical sect in Jambudīpa, so named because its members lived on Mount Himavata, who held that a Bodhisatta is not an ordinary mortal, that even outsiders can possess the five higher knowledges, and that the individual is distinct from the aggregates.
